What kinds of projects and tasks can a Programming Intern expect to work on during their internship?

Programming Interns typically support ongoing development projects by writing and testing code, fixing bugs, and assisting with documentation. You may be assigned to work on specific modules, perform code reviews, or help automate repetitive tasks under the guidance of senior developers. Interns often participate in team meetings, collaborate closely with other interns and full-time engineers, and gain exposure to version control systems and agile workflows. These experiences are designed to help you build practical skills while contributing meaningfully to the team's goals.

What does a programming intern do?

A programming intern assists with software development tasks such as writing, testing, and debugging code under the supervision of experienced developers. They often work with programming languages like Python, Java, or C++, and may gain experience using development tools, version control systems, and collaborative platforms. The role provides hands-on learning opportunities in a professional coding environ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Programming Intern,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Programming Intern, you generally need a solid understanding of programming fundamentals, data structures, and algorithms, often gained through coursework in computer science or related fields.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, basic debugging tools, and at least one programming language such as Python, Java, or C++ is typically expected. Strong problem-solving skills, eagerness to learn, and the ability to communicate effectively within a team help interns stand out. These skills and qualities are crucial for quickly adapting to real-world projects, collaborating with colleagues, and making meaningful contributions during the internship.

About the team

The Cloud Engineering Team uses modern tools and best practices to automate new functions and features in cloud applications and infrastructure. Through a software engineering lens, we improve consistency and reliability across multiple cloud platforms using GitOps, Terraform, and ArgoCD (for Kubernetes applications). We are passionate about code and the power of automation to simplify complex processes.

As aย Co-op/Intern Cloud Developer, Platform Engineeringย within the Cloud Engineering Team, you will learn about how DevOps, automation, CI/CD pipeline, GitOps, infrastructure, development and monitoring drive the successful deployment of cloud infrastructure and applications
